MCP Launchpad

A lightweight CLI for discovering and executing tools from multiple MCP (Model Context Protocol) servers.

Installation

Prerequisite: uv - Python package and environment manager

uv tool install https://github.com/kenneth-liao/mcp-launchpad.git

Verify it works:

mcpl --help

Configuration

Create mcp.json in your project directory (or ~/.claude/mcp.json for global config):

{
  "mcpServers": {
    "filesystem": {
      "command": "npx",
      "args": ["-y", "@anthropic/mcp-server-filesystem", "/path/to/allowed/dir"]
    }
  }
}

Validate with mcpl list. If you don't see your servers, restart your terminal and run mcpl list --refresh.

Config Discovery

MCP Launchpad searches for config files in this order:

  1. ./mcp.json - Project-level config
  2. ./.claude/mcp.json - Project-level Claude config
  3. ~/.claude/mcp.json - User-level config

When multiple config files are found, mcpl prompts you to select which ones to use. Your preferences are saved and can be changed later with mcpl config files --select.

Agent Integration

MCP Launchpad works with any AI agent that can run bash commands (Claude Code, Cursor, Windsurf, etc.).

Copy the root CLAUDE.md contents into your own CLAUDE.md or AGENTS.md to teach your agent how to use mcpl. This can be done at the project level (./CLAUDE.md) or user level (~/.claude/CLAUDE.md).

Important: OAuth Authentication

Agents cannot complete OAuth flows because they require browser interaction. You must authenticate all OAuth-protected MCP servers before agents can use them:

mcpl auth login <server>    # Authenticate a specific server
mcpl list --refresh         # Prompts to authenticate each server that requires OAuth
mcpl auth status            # Verify all servers are authenticated

Session Daemon

MCP Launchpad uses a session daemon to maintain persistent connections to MCP servers, improving performance for repeated calls. The daemon starts automatically on first mcpl call.

Automatic Cleanup

Environment Cleanup Trigger
Regular terminal Parent terminal process exits
VS Code / Claude Code IDE session ends (detected via VS Code socket)
Any environment Idle timeout (default: 1 hour of no activity)
Manual mcpl session stop command

Troubleshooting

mcpl session status                         # Check daemon status
mcpl session stop                           # Stop the daemon manually
mcpl call github list_repos '{}' --no-daemon  # Bypass daemon for debugging

If you encounter persistent issues, stopping and restarting the daemon usually resolves them.

HTTP Server Configuration

HTTP servers connect to remote MCP endpoints over HTTP.

{
  "mcpServers": {
    "remote-api": {
      "type": "http",
      "url": "https://api.example.com/mcp",
      "headers": {
        "Authorization": "Bearer ${API_TOKEN}"
      }
    }
  }
}
Field Required Description
type Yes Must be "http"
url Yes Full URL to the MCP endpoint
headers No HTTP headers (supports ${VAR} syntax)

For OAuth-protected servers, see OAuth Authentication.

SSE Transport Configuration

Some legacy MCP servers use Server-Sent Events (SSE) instead of the newer Streamable HTTP transport:

{
  "mcpServers": {
    "legacy-server": {
      "type": "sse",
      "url": "https://legacy.example.com/sse",
      "headers": {
        "Authorization": "Bearer ${API_TOKEN}"
      }
    }
  }
}

Note: SSE transport is provided for compatibility with older MCP servers. New servers should use standard HTTP transport.

OAuth Authentication

Some remote MCP servers (like Notion, Figma, and other cloud services) require OAuth authentication. MCP Launchpad handles this securely using OAuth 2.1 with PKCE.

Quick Start

When you connect to a server that requires authentication, mcpl will prompt you:

$ mcpl list notion --refresh
Server 'notion' requires OAuth authentication.
Would you like to authenticate now? [Y/n]

Or authenticate proactively:

mcpl auth login notion

This opens your browser for authorization. After you approve, tokens are stored securely.

Commands

Command Description
mcpl auth login <server> Authenticate with an OAuth-protected server
mcpl auth logout <server> Remove stored authentication
mcpl auth logout --all Clear all stored tokens
mcpl auth status [server] Show authentication status

Configuration

For servers that require pre-registered OAuth credentials:

{
  "mcpServers": {
    "notion": {
      "type": "http",
      "url": "https://mcp.notion.com/mcp",
      "oauth_client_id": "${NOTION_CLIENT_ID}",
      "oauth_client_secret": "${NOTION_CLIENT_SECRET}",
      "oauth_scopes": ["read", "write"]
    }
  }
}

Tokens are encrypted and stored locally in ~/.cache/mcp-launchpad/oauth/ using your system's keyring.

Troubleshooting

Issue Solution
"Server requires OAuth authentication" Run mcpl auth login <server>
Token expired Run mcpl auth login <server> --force
Browser doesn't open Copy the URL from terminal and open manually
"Invalid client" errors Check oauth_client_id and oauth_client_secret
Keyring warnings Using fallback encryption (still secure)
"Metadata fetch failed" Configure credentials manually in mcp.json

Login Options

mcpl auth login notion                     # Basic authentication
mcpl auth login figma --scope "read write" # Request specific scopes
mcpl auth login custom --force             # Re-authenticate (replace existing tokens)
mcpl auth login server --client-id "id"    # Specific client ID

# Secure secret input (recommended)
echo "secret" | mcpl auth login server --client-secret-stdin

# Or via environment variable
export MCPL_CLIENT_SECRET="secret"

Options:

  • --scope TEXT - Additional OAuth scopes to request
  • --force - Force re-authentication even if already logged in
  • --client-id TEXT - Use a specific OAuth client ID
  • --client-secret-stdin - Read client secret from stdin
  • --timeout INTEGER - Browser callback timeout (default: 120 seconds)

Client Registration Strategy

MCP Launchpad uses a flexible registration approach:

  1. Config file - Pre-configured credentials in mcp.json
  2. DCR - Dynamic Client Registration if supported by the server
  3. Interactive - Manual input as fallback

This approach is more flexible than Claude Code, which requires DCR support.

Server Compatibility

MCP Launchpad supports OAuth servers with varying levels of standards compliance:

  • RFC 9728 - MCP-native OAuth servers with /.well-known/oauth-authorization-server at the MCP resource path
  • RFC 8414 - Standard OAuth servers with /.well-known/oauth-authorization-server at the server root
  • Non-compliant - Servers without metadata discovery (falls back to manual configuration)

Security Features

  • Fernet encryption (AES-128-CBC + HMAC) for tokens at rest
  • OS keyring integration (Keychain on macOS, libsecret on Linux, DPAPI on Windows)
  • PKCE with S256 (RFC 7636) for secure authorization
  • Token revocation on logout (RFC 7009)
  • HTTPS enforcement for all OAuth endpoints

Note: If OS keyring is unavailable, a warning will be displayed and tokens will use fallback encryption.

Environment Variables

Common settings you may need to configure:

Variable Default Description
MCPL_CONFIG_FILES (auto) Comma-separated list of config files (overrides discovery)
MCPL_CONNECTION_TIMEOUT 45 Server connection timeout in seconds
MCPL_IDLE_TIMEOUT 3600 Daemon idle timeout (0 to disable)

Connection Settings

Variable Default Description
MCPL_CONNECTION_TIMEOUT 45 MCP server connection/initialization timeout (seconds)
MCPL_RECONNECT_DELAY 5 Delay before retrying a failed server connection (seconds)
MCPL_MAX_RECONNECT_ATTEMPTS 3 Max reconnection attempts before giving up

Daemon Settings

Variable Default Description
MCPL_DAEMON_START_TIMEOUT 30 Max time to wait for daemon startup (seconds)
MCPL_DAEMON_CONNECT_RETRY_DELAY 0.2 Delay between connection attempts to daemon (seconds)
MCPL_PARENT_CHECK_INTERVAL 5 How often daemon checks if parent process is alive (seconds)

IDE/Session Settings

Variable Default Description
MCPL_IDLE_TIMEOUT 3600 Shut down daemon after this many seconds of inactivity (0 to disable)
MCPL_IDE_ANCHOR_CHECK_INTERVAL 10 How often to check if IDE session is still active (seconds)
MCPL_SESSION_ID (auto) Override the session ID (for testing or advanced multi-session setups)

Platform Notes

Windows (Experimental)

Windows support uses named pipes for IPC communication. While functional, it may have limitations compared to Unix sockets on macOS/Linux.

If you encounter issues:

  1. Use --no-daemon flag to bypass the session daemon
  2. Set MCPL_SESSION_ID explicitly if session detection is unreliable
  3. Report issues at https://github.com/kenneth-liao/mcp-launchpad/issues

Features

  • Unified Tool Discovery - Search across all configured MCP servers with BM25, regex, or exact matching
  • Persistent Connections - Session daemon maintains server connections for faster repeated calls
  • HTTP & Stdio Support - Connect to both local process-based servers and remote HTTP/Streamable MCP servers
  • SSE Transport Support - Connect to legacy MCP servers using Server-Sent Events
  • Multi-Config Management - Use multiple config files simultaneously with interactive selection
  • OAuth 2.1 Authentication - Secure authentication for OAuth-protected MCP servers (Notion, Figma, etc.)
  • Auto-Configuration - Reads from ./mcp.json (project-level) or ~/.claude/mcp.json (user-level)
  • Cross-Platform - Works on macOS, Linux, and Windows (experimental)
  • JSON Mode - Machine-readable output for scripting and automation
